What does an Accounts Payable (AP) Clerk do?
An AP clerk is responsible for a range of accounting and clerical tasks, including receiving, processing, and verifying invoices, tracking and recording purchase orders, and processing payments. Many AP clerks have an associate's degree in accounting that gives them a background in accounting best practices. Some of the key skills a successful AP clerk should have are attention to detail, time management, and communication.
AP Clerk Salary Averages
United States
According to ZipRecruiter, the average salary for an AP Clerk in the United States is $43,362 a year. The city offering the highest salary is Federal Way, Washington, offering $52,302 per year.
Canada
According to Indeed, the average salary for an AP Clerk in Canada is $41,638 per year. The city offering the highest salary is Calgary, Alberta, offering $50,321 per year.
What does an AP Specialist do?
AP Specialists take care of the AP process from purchase order to payment, including proper recording of each step for easy referencing in the future. An AP Specialist requires a fundamental understanding of how to file invoices, make payments, and manage tax filings for companies. Specific responsibilities for this role include:
- Fielding vendor and employee inquiries
- Solving any AP discrepancies (missing purchase orders, mismatched invoices, etc.)
- Completing payments in a timely manner and recording them using the company’s preferred payment tracking methods
- Reconciling financial statements and forecasts
AP Specialist Salary Averages
United States
According to ZipRecruiter, the average salary for an AP Specialist in the United States ranges between $30,500 to $66,000 per year. The city reporting the highest salary is Federal Way, Washington, offering $59,989 per year.
Canada
According to Talent.com, the average salary for an AP Specialist in Canada ranges between $46,800 to $59,121 per year.
What does an AP Manager do?
Most large enterprises with a dedicated AP department typically need an AP Manager. An AP Manager’s responsibilities include maintaining accurate records about payments to suppliers, processing payments from clients, enforcing GAAP (Generally Accepted Accounting Principles) and industry standards, and training staff members. In some cases, AP Managers will also be asked to maintain ledgers and databases, oversee tax-related processes, and find innovative ways to align their team members with specific business goals.
AP Manager Salary Averages
United States
According to Indeed, the average salary for an AP Manager in the United States ranges between $55,428 to $106,104 per year. The city reporting the highest salary is San Francisco, California, offering $95,563 per year.
Canada
According to Indeed, the average salary for an AP Manager in Canada is $79,842 per year. The city reporting the highest salary is Mississauga, Ontario, offering $100,588 per year.
